My Students

"Every student can learn, just not on the same day or in the same way" is a quote by George Evans that describes my students perfectly! My nine students with special needs are in a full inclusion classroom; they are exposed to a high level of rigor each day as they learn sixth grade standards with support from both a general education teacher and an intervention specialist.

My students are capable and hungry to learn grade level material but need supports and accommodations to help them achieve the high standards set for them.

Our school is a Pre K to 8th grade STEM school located in the inner city of Cleveland, with an enrollment of approximately 400. All students receive a free breakfast and lunch.

We live out the "T" in STEM each day as our students' learning is enhanced with 1:1 devices. This is especially beneficial to my students as they no longer struggle to read and comprehend grade level material because the technology can read aloud to them. As sixth graders, with strong desires to "fit in" with their general education peers, this is priceless.

My Project

Earbuds were listed on the sixth grade school supply list, but not all students can afford supplies. Of the students that had their own earbuds more than half have been misplaced or broken and not replaced. My students spend a portion of their language arts and math class using individualized computer-based programs tailored to fit the skills they are lacking (anything from identifying short vowel sounds to dividing decimals using a standard algorithm to identifying theme in a literary text to multiplying fractions) and earbuds allow the children to be engaged in their independent work, not focused on what skill a classmate is working on.

When every student has a quality pair of earbuds, the classroom volume decreases and the room is transformed to a quiet, focused setting where each child is instructed on his/her own personal level, reaching their own personal goals free from distractions.
